Size and Weight Comparison The size of a lens is a crucial factor to consider when comparing two lenses. 7Artisans 24mm f1.8 is the longer of the two lenses at 92mm. The Canon EF-M 15-45mm F3.5-6.3 with a length of 45mm, is 47mm shorter. Besides being longer, the 7Artisans 24mm f1.8 also has a larger diameter of 72mm compared to the Canon EF-M 15-45mm F3.5-6.3's 61mm diameter.

Comparison image of the 7Artisans 24mm f1.8 and the Canon EF-M 15-45mm F3.5-6.3 Size and Weight The weight of a lens is equally significant as its external dimensions, particularly if you intend to handhold your camera and lens combination for extended periods. Canon EF-M 15-45mm F3.5-6.3 weighs 130g, 69% (294g) lighter than the 7Artisans 24mm f1.8's weight of 424g.
Filter Threads
The 7Artisans 24mm f1.8 has a filter size of 62mm whereas the Canon EF-M 15-45mm F3.5-6.3 has a 49mm diameter. Larger filters are generally more expensive than the smaller ones given all the other features are equal.

Focal Range
7Artisans 24mm f1.8 is a prime lens with fixed focal lenght of 24mm. When it is mounted on an APS-C sensor camera with 1.5x crop, it provides a 35mm (FF) equivalent of
36mm .
On the other hand, the Canon EF-M 15-45mm F3.5-6.3 has a focal range of 15-45mm and 3.0X zoom ratio which has an effective (full-frame 35mm equivalent) focal range of 22.5-67.5mm when used on a APS-C / DX format camera.
